Ingredients
Scale
- 4 Chicken thighs
- 1 cup Pineapple juice
- 1/2 cup Soy sauce
- 1/4 cup Brown sugar
- 2 tbsp Ginger, grated
- 2 cloves Garlic, minced
- 1/2 tsp Black pepper
- Rice, for serving
- Grilled pineapple, for serving
Instructions
- Mix pineapple juice, soy sauce, brown sugar, grated ginger, minced garlic, and black pepper to create the marinade.
- Marinate the chicken thighs in the mixture for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ight.
-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.
- Grill the marinated chicken thighs for 6-8 minutes on each side, or until fully cooked and caramelized.
- Serve the chicken with coconut rice or a fresh salad and grilled pineapple.
Notes
For extra flavor, marinate overnight. Keep an eye on the grill to avoid charring. Add red pepper flakes for spice.
